Project Manager DOE/Hanford ProjectsElite Construction & Development is expanding our federal and environmental project portfolio and anticipates the award of significant work at the Hanford Site. We are seeking an experienced Project Manager with DOE/Hanford project experience to support this growth and lead complex, highly regulated projects from planning through execution.This role is ideal for a PM who:understands the unique demands of the Hanford cleanup mission,excels in a procedure-driven, regulatory-heavy environment,can coordinate multi-disciplinary teams, andconsistently delivers safe, compliant, high-quality work.If you have successfully managed projects within the DOE complexor directly supported contractors performing work at Hanfordwe want to talk.The Project Manager DOE/Hanford Projects is responsible for the planning, execution, compliance management, and delivery of assigned federal, environmental, and infrastructure-related projects at the Hanford Site.The PM ensures work is performed safely, in accordance with DOE expectations, applicable regulations, contractual requirements, and Hanford Site procedures. This includes oversight of project engineering, subcontractor performance, field execution, documentation, and schedule/cost controls.Reports to: Sr Project ManagerSupervises: Project Engineers, Field Supervision, and SubcontractorsEssential Duties & Responsibilities:Lead project execution in accordance with DOE Orders, Hanford Site procedures, and contract requirements.Manage technical submittals, engineering reviews, and project documentation in compliance with Hanford systemsEnsure strict compliance with Conduct of Operations, work control processes, hazard analyses, and safety/environmental controls.Develop and maintain project schedules (MS Project or P6).Support earned value, cost tracking, forecasting, and variance reporting consistent with federal project management expectations.Maintain performance against approved scope, schedule, and budget baselines.Prepare and manage Statements of Work, risk registers, CERCLA or environmental documentation, and technical clarifications.Ensure project records, deliverables, and correspondence meet DOE and Hanford quality requirements.Oversee subcontractor planning, documentation, mobilization, and field execution.Monitor compliance with site safety, radiological controls, environmental requirements, and quality expectations.Serve as the primary point of contact with DOE-affiliated organizations, engineering teams, and internal project stakeholders.Lead project meetings, prepare status reports, and maintain alignment across project, engineering, safety, and field personnel.Champion Hanford's rigorous safety culture and ensure all work is executed under approved work packages and hazard controls.Conduct field walkdowns, readiness verifications, and compliance inspections.Minimum Requirements:5+ years of project management experience on DOE, Hanford, nuclear, or similarly regulated industrial projects.Demonstrated understanding of DOE project management frameworksExperience managing submittals, technical reviews, and regulated documentation workflows.Ability to read and interpret engineering drawings, technical specifications, and work control documents.Proficiency with MS Project and MS Office 365.Strong communication, leadership, and organizational skills.Must be able to obtain and maintain Hanford Site access.The ideal candidate:Degree in Construction Management, Engineering, or a related technical field.Experience working for or supporting prime contractors at the Hanford Site.PMP, EIT, or other relevant certifications.Experience in environmental cleanup, facility modernization, demolition prep, or infrastructure upgrades on DOE sites.Other requirements:Possess the right to work and remain in the US without sponsorshipMust be at least 21 years old and pass a criminal backgroundMust be able to pass pre-employment drug screening for safety sensitive positionsPossess a valid driver's license and insurable driving recordSalary: $95,994 minimum to $113,494 midpoint, $130,000 superior candidateTypically, candidates are hired between the minimum and midpoint of the salary range based on applicable experience, qualifications, and alignment with preferred skills.Benefits:Medical Insurance - 2 plans to choose fromDental Insurance - In and out of network benefitsVision Insurance - Employees have the option of 2 vision plansShort and Long-Term Disability - 5 plans to choose fromHealth Savings Account with company-added contributionEmployer-paid Life Insurance with the option to purchase additional life insurance.401(k) with 4% company matchAccrue 104 hours paid time off (PTO) annually to startNine (9) Paid HolidaysFLSA Status: ExemptThe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A) establishes minimum wage and overtime requirements for employees.
